Water use restrictions were in place in Connecticut to conserve water amid the drought. East Lyme officials enacted mandatory, twice-weekly irrigation schedule for residents and businesses as of Aug. 15. The Aquarion Water Company issued a mandatory water conservation schedule for its customers through Oct. 31. The Connecticut Water Company and Regional Water Authority of New Haven asked customers to curb their water use by 15% and 10%, respectively. Norwich Public Utilities urged its customers to “make reasonable adjustments to their water use" while drought persists. A water usage restriction was also issued in Putnam to discourage car washing and lawn watering. CT News Junkie (Hartford, Conn.), Aug. 23, 2022
